I have both these and airpods pro for almost two years. I use airpods way more often as I like the fit better. To be fair, Bose fit is ok too, AirPods just a bit softer on my ears. The connectivity of airpods is much much better with iphone. However I second what other people say - for music I much prefer the Bose. I mostly listen to podcasts so don't care much. Microphone on Bose is much worse, but kinda ok if it is not noisy. Noise cancellation is better on Bose, but the difference is not that dramatic to me. Connectivity issues on Bose could be very annoying, don't underestimate, sometimes I want to throw them out of the window. Overall I'd pick airpods over these, but if I mostly listened to music I might pick Bose.

I have these. The fix for the Bluetooth issue is to not use the app. Disable it. Mine has worked great since I did this. The con about the fix is you can adjust the bass and treble except on the app, which you have to disable to fix the connection issue.
